Working Procedure

    • Contributor Process: Contributors register via the portal, suggest topics, and submit them online. The Core Committee evaluates these, finalizes topics, and requests formal content (articles, videos, infographics, etc.).
    • Review Process: Submitted content goes to the Editorial Section. Each piece is reviewed by two editors and two peers within a maximum of 14 working days, following these guidelines.
    • Feedback Loop: Editors send suggestions or observations back to contributors if changes are needed.
    • Approval: Accepted content moves to the Core Committee for publication.

Rules for Editors

As an editor, your role is to ensure every submission meets our high standards. Here’s what to do:

Verify Information:

  • Check facts against credible, evidence-based sources (e.g., peer-reviewed journals, WHO guidelines).
  • Avoid anecdotal content—focus on proven data only.
  • Flag and update any outdated information to keep it current.

Assess Clarity and Accessibility:

  • Ensure the content is logically organized and easy to follow.
  • Replace medical jargon with simple terms (e.g., “high blood pressure” instead of “hypertension”) and demand clear explanations if terms remain.
  • Encourage visual aids like images, diagrams, or infographics to boost understanding—appreciate their use!

Ensure Patient-Centered Language:

  • Confirm the tone is simple, practical, and respectful to the audience.
  • Verify uses patient-centric phrasing (e.g., “You can manage this at home” rather than “Patients must do this”).
  • Check that it offers actionable steps for real-world use.

Review Conflict of Interest:

  • Look for the mandatory conflict of interest disclaimer in every submission.
  • Ensure no hidden biases or commercial influences (e.g., product promotions) sneak in.

Adherence to Contributor Guidelines:

  • Confirm the word count is between 800-1500 words.
  • Verify references and citations are included and link to reliable resources or support groups (e.g., illness-specific communities).
  • Ensure accuracy, reliability, and validity of the content as per evidence-based standards.

Additional Notes

    • Timeline: Stick to the 14-day review period. If more time is needed, coordinate with the Core Committee.
    • Collaboration: Work with your peer reviewers to align feedback and maintain consistency.
    • Feedback Quality: Provide clear, constructive suggestions to contributors (e.g., “Add a diagram for clarity” or “Simplify this sentence”).
